An 8×8 array antenna based on dielectric resonator antennas (DRA) fed by a slot antennas is proposed as a base-station antenna for millimeter-wave 5G wireless communications. The total radiation efficiency is modeled as a function of frequency and beam steering. It turns out that the total radiation efficiency is higher than 80% over the frequency band from 26 GHz to 34 GHz and for scan angles up to 60 degrees along the H-plane. The DRA can perform beam steering over wide bandwidth with a scan-loss comparable to the array factor of an ideal source. In addition, The DRA array is 20% smaller in size compared to conventional half-spaced antenna arrays.
